A scientific visit was carried out by the Department of Computer Science at the University of Al Maarif to the Distinguished Students’ High School in Anbar Governorate within the framework of the “Digital Citizen” initiative.

In line with the “Digital Citizen” initiative and in implementation of the University of Al Maarif’s vision to keep pace with modern technological developments, the Department of Computer Science organized this scientific visit as part of its efforts to enhance technological awareness and spread the culture of digital transformation within educational institutions.The visit was conducted under an initiative launched by the President of the University of Al Maarif, Assistant Professor Dr. Mahmoud Abdulrazzaq Al-Saadi, which aims to clarify the mechanisms for transforming traditional services into technology-based digital services, thereby contributing to improved institutional performance and facilitating educational and administrative procedures.The visit was supervised and followed up by the Dean of the College of Science, Assistant Professor Dr. Mohammed Ibrahim Khalaf, with the participation of a number of faculty members from the Department of Computer Science and a group of department students. A simplified explanation was presented on the concepts of digital transformation, the importance of modern technologies in developing the educational process, and the role of computer science in building a generation capable of meeting the requirements of the digital age.This visit comes as part of a series of scientific and community activities through which the University of Al Maarif seeks to strengthen communication with educational institutions and support outstanding students, in a manner that serves the educational process and contributes to preparing technologically aware youth with future-oriented skills.
